Our Centre Services

Centres are at the heart of the support provided by Headway Devon. Every week, at our seven adult centres across the county, people with brain injuries come together for rehabilitation.

We provide support and rehabilitation for adults with acquired brain injuries at locations in Exeter, Exmouth, Honiton, Crediton, Tiverton, West Devon, and South Devon. We also offer support for children affected by brain injuries at a centre in Exeter.

If you were to visit a Headway Devon centre on a typical day, you might find clients engaged in any number of activities. The emphasis is on re-learning lost  skills and developing new ones. Board games, art activities, and social interaction all help clients to reach these objectives.

Staff work with each client to decide what activities they will take part in and what aims they will work towards. These aims are entered onto individual  care plans and the client's progress is monitored at regular intervals. This means that client and staff alike can see the progress that is being made and  can make positive decisions about moving forward in the rehabilitation process.

As an example of an activity which has recently taken place at one of our centres, in Exeter, many clients took part in a print-making course which was provided by the Double Elephant Print Workshop and delivered in partnership with Headway Devon staff and volunteers. This was an opportunity for clients to discover new skills and work with people from outside Headway Devon.

The work that goes on at our centres is long-term, and progress for individual clients often takes years, not months. But this never stops clients and staff from looking forward to a bright future.
